1. How can I create a GoFundMe campaign that actually gets donations?
Most campaigns fail before they even start because the page itself doesn’t convert visitors into donors. A strong story, clear title, high-quality photos/videos, and transparent explanation of exactly how the money will be used are non-negotiable.
Donors need to instantly understand who you are, why you’re raising funds, and exactly where their money is going. Vague or overly emotional copy without specifics kills trust. The best pages feel personal yet professional—they tell a story that makes strangers feel emotionally connected and logically confident their donation will help.
Pro tip: Update your page regularly with photos, progress reports, and thank-yous. Campaigns that post consistent updates raise significantly more because they keep donors engaged and bring new visitors back.
2. Where should I share my GoFundMe link to reach the most potential donors?
This is one of the biggest pain points. Posting once on Facebook and hoping for the best rarely works.
Best places to share:
- Start with your warm network (close friends/family) and ask them to share too.
- Post multiple times across Facebook, Instagram, TikTok, X (Twitter), Nextdoor, and relevant Facebook Groups.
- Email your full contact list with a personal message (not just the link).
- Share in community forums, Reddit threads (following rules), and local news groups.
The key isn’t just where—it’s how often and how you ask. Generic “Please donate” posts get ignored. Heartfelt, specific updates with clear calls-to-action perform far better. 3. Why do most new GoFundMe campaigns lose steam after initial shares—and how do I prevent it?
Data shows the vast majority of campaigns peak in the first week and then flatline. The reason? They rely entirely on personal networks and run out of fresh eyes. Social media algorithms bury repeated posts, and without new traffic sources, donations dry up.
The fix is a phased promotion plan: pre-launch audience building, compelling storytelling that converts cold traffic, regular updates, and ongoing visibility tactics that keep your campaign in front of new people. Top fundraisers treat promotion like a marketing campaign—not a one-time share blast.
